WebDepolarization - definition. movement of a cell's membrane potential to a more positive value (i.e. movement closer to zero from resting membrane potential). When a neuron is depolarized, it is more likely to fire an action potential. Watch this 2-Minute Neuroscience video to learn more about membrane potential. WebThe length constant is the distance over which the magnitude of the depolarization falls to a value of 1/e (e = 2.718) of the initial depolarization. The length constant for a small neuron with a large number of resting K+ channels (black curve) can be as small as 0.1 mm; in this example it is about 0.5 mm.
